Summary

Caroline Byrd is a seasoned professional in the medical device industry, currently serving as the VP of Regulatory, Quality, and Clinical at Nextern. With a strong foundation in Lean Product Lifecycle Management, she excels in cross-functional communication and has a proven track record of driving process improvements in complex organizations. Caroline's leadership experience spans various roles, including Director positions at Leica Biosystems and Abbott, where she managed large teams and significant budgets. Her expertise encompasses regulatory compliance, quality systems, and product development, making her a valuable asset in navigating the intricacies of medical device regulations. Caroline's career reflects her commitment to enhancing patient lives through innovative solutions and rigorous quality standards. She has also contributed to significant organizational changes, integrating global teams to adapt to evolving regulatory landscapes. Beyond her technical skills, Caroline is passionate about fostering collaboration and communication across departments to achieve strategic goals.
